What Is Covered Under the Lifetime Warranty
| Coverage Area | Included Under Lifetime Warranty |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Workmanship Defects | Yes | Repair or replacement if defect confirmed |
| Material Defects | Yes | Includes structural metal issues |
| Synthetic Birthstones | Yes | Replaced if defective |
| Polish Restoration | Yes | Finish can be restored at no charge |
| Ring Replacement | Yes | If defect cannot be repaired |
| Refund | Possible | If repair or replacement cannot be completed |
| Resizing | Not Free | Sizing fee applies |
| Precious Stones (Diamond, Sapphire, etc.) | No | Not covered under warranty |
| Outside Repairs | Voids Warranty | Must be serviced by Dunham Jewelry |
What Is Not Covered (And Why That Matters)
Not everything qualifies under lifetime protection. For example, resizing requires a fee. Precious and semi-precious stones such as diamonds, topaz, or sapphire are also excluded.
Why does this distinction exist? Natural stones can chip, crack, or loosen from impact. That type of damage is usually considered wear and tear, not a manufacturing flaw.
Meanwhile, if another jeweler performs work on the ring, the warranty becomes void. This protects quality control. Once altered externally, the original workmanship can no longer be guaranteed.
